Diocese of Phoenix Young Adult Survey

This year the Catholic Church throughout the world has been celebrating a Jubilee Year of Hope, rooted in St. Paul’s message: "Hope does not disappoint" (Rm 5:5).

In this context, the Diocese of Phoenix is reaching out to young adults age 18-39 to hear from them about their experience in the Church and their perspectives on important issues like relationships, family, and life. Bishop John Dolan would like to hear from as many young adults as possible — he wants to hear your voice! To accomplish this, the Diocese is in the process of a Synod of Young Adults, with both in-person gatherings and this online survey. (Synod is a Greek word that means journeying or walking together).
